Output 03aa688caa34e81c1153b74cb933499f3852dd2e247700a99e964b3a199f9e90:1

value
20883366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a68d00136776cfd8f8dec622c59e59273af388 OP_EQUAL
address
MKzYwuL5J8e5C8atNXaAY6jfE1gFRgMS9E
transaction
03aa688caa34e81c1153b74cb933499f3852dd2e247700a99e964b3a199f9e90
spent
true